Well they were gone a couple years ago. They must be resurrected. Ah, they are now designed in California. Not the same company, now a brand.
They once had a facility in Chatsworth CA, which I believe was manufacturing as well as corporate offices. At one time some products were made in USA and others (4-digit bag numbers) were made in China. Then they moved to Marina Del Rey. That address, I believe, is corporate offices only. I never heard that they ever “went away”.

You’re likely right that they transitioned from a company to a brand... but who hasn’t? Build a great company with great products and sales figures to go with it... and sell for a real profit. It’s the American way.
